Orientation is held in Caseyville, IL right outside of St. Louis.
Pet Policy is $300.00, taken out in $100.00 increments until paid. $250.- of that is refundable, unless you have damages. The other $50.00 they keep for cleaning. This is a one time fee, even if you move trucks.
